Title Lotus Turbo Challenge v1.0
Description A fast-paced racing game presented from a second-person 3D perspective. You must complete each course while racing against the clock and avoiding opponent cars. There are six courses, each with different scenery and climatic effects.
Author Badja (badja@calc.org)
Category TI-83/84 Plus Assembly Games (Ion)
File Size 15,441 bytes
File Date and Time Tue Nov 2 00:40:15 1999
Documentation Included? Yes
Source Code Included? No
